Eden Academy Trust

Each of the Seven SEN Schools in the Eden Academy Trust, specialise in meeting the educational needs of children and young people with a range of learning disabilities including those who are autistic, and those who have physical or sensory needs.

Occupational Therapy

We passionately believe that therapies, including occupational therapy, are a vital part of school life and help our pupils access their education. Our amazing team of occupational therapists help each pupil achieve as much independence as possible within their activities of daily living.

The Role

To support the occupational therapy team under the supervision and guidance of occupational therapists based across The Eden Academy Trust.

To deliver occupational therapy programmes and recommendations devised by an occupational therapist. To carry out functional skills in 1:1 and group sessions in the classroom, or therapy space under the guidance of an occupational therapist. To support the occupational therapist to deliver therapy interventions and documentation that support children's Educational Health Care Plans (EHCP's)

Successful candidates will be expected to undertake a manual handling course. Please refer to the job description for further information.

Regular supervision, guidance and CPD opportunities are available.
